Budgeting is the process of allocating finite resources to the prioritized needs of an organization. In most cases‚ for a governmental entity‚ the budget represents the legal authority to spend money.     SHARE CAPITAL Share capital is the Funds raised by issuing shares in return for cash or other considerations. The amount of share capital a company has can change over time because each time a business sells new shares to the public in exchange for cash‚ the amount of share capital will increase. Share capital can be composed of both common and preferred shares. Each share carrying a vote in the management of the business‚ managerial control may be limited.
